Product Description:
The MSK101D-0200-NN-M1-AG2-NSNN is a synchronous servo motor manufactured by Bosch Rexroth Indramat for the MSK IndraDyn S Synchronous Motors series. In tightly integrated drive trains, it converts electrical power into rotational motion with high position fidelity, so machine tools, gantry systems, and packaging lines can execute programmed profiles with repeatable accuracy. It is suited for applications that require precise positioning, stable speed regulation, and coordinated axis movement during continuous machine operation. When paired with compatible Rexroth drive controllers, the motor becomes part of a closed-loop automation system that delivers torque on demand while returning absolute position data for accurate motion control.
Heat generated in the stator is removed by natural convection, and the Cooling FN arrangement requires free airflow around the housing. Winding code 0200 is used with the D-length frame and the 101 size lamination stack to match the electrical characteristics expected by the drive. Torque is transmitted through a plain shaft, and an electrically released brake provides 70 Nm of static holding force for vertical axes. Connections exit on the A-side of the housing, which helps keep cable routing consistent at the machine interface. The motor has an IP65 rating, supports continuous duty from 0 to 40 °C, and uses insulation rated for 155 °C.
Position feedback is exchanged through the Hiperface digital interface. Within the encoder module, an optical sensor resolves the code disk into 128 signal periods per revolution, and the turn counter stores position in a multi-turn absolute format so shaft orientation is retained after power cycles. This encoder arrangement supports accurate low-speed regulation and synchronized multi-axis motion, especially where timing errors can affect product handling or path accuracy. The motor is suitable for standard factory areas and for zones that require basic explosion protection.
